什么不是数据库对象查询
-
在数据库中,不是所有的对象都可以进行查询。以下是一些不是数据库对象查询的例子:
-
数据库连接:数据库连接是用来建立应用程序与数据库之间的通信通道,它负责处理连接的建立和断开。数据库连接本身不是查询对象,它只是用来连接数据库的工具。
-
数据库事务:数据库事务是一组对数据库进行操作的语句,它们被视为一个单独的工作单元,要么全部执行成功,要么全部失败回滚。事务本身不是查询对象,它是一种用于管理数据库操作的机制。
-
数据库表结构:数据库表结构定义了表的字段和数据类型,它描述了数据的组织方式。表结构本身不是查询对象,它只是用来存储数据的结构。
-
数据库索引:数据库索引是用来提高查询效率的数据结构,它可以加快对数据的查找速度。索引本身不是查询对象,它只是用来帮助查询操作的工具。
-
数据库触发器:数据库触发器是一种特殊的存储过程,它在数据库发生特定事件时自动执行。触发器本身不是查询对象,它是一种用于自动执行操作的机制。
总结起来,数据库对象查询通常指的是对数据库中的数据进行查询操作。而数据库连接、事务、表结构、索引和触发器都不是数据查询的对象,它们是用来管理和组织数据的工具和机制。
1年前 -
-
在数据库中,查询是一种常见的操作,用于检索和获取所需的数据。数据库对象是存储、管理和操作数据的基本单位,包括表、视图、索引、触发器、存储过程等。在查询过程中,我们可以操作这些数据库对象来获取特定的数据结果。然而,并不是所有的数据库对象都适合用于查询操作。
首先,数据库中的约束不是用于查询的对象。约束是用于保证数据的完整性和一致性的规则,例如主键约束、唯一约束、外键约束等。约束主要用于限制数据的输入和修改操作,而不是用于查询操作。虽然我们可以在查询中使用约束来进行条件过滤,但约束本身并不是查询对象。
其次,数据库中的触发器也不是用于查询的对象。触发器是一种特殊的数据库对象,它在指定的数据库事件发生时自动执行一系列操作。触发器通常与表相关联,并在表的数据发生变化时触发。触发器主要用于实现数据的自动化处理和业务逻辑的实现,而不是用于查询操作。
此外,数据库中的存储过程也不是用于查询的对象。存储过程是一组预编译的SQL语句和逻辑操作的集合,可以在数据库中进行复用。存储过程通常用于实现复杂的业务逻辑和数据处理操作,而不是用于查询操作。尽管存储过程中可能包含查询语句,但它本身并不是查询对象。
总的来说,约束、触发器和存储过程都是数据库中的重要组件,但它们并不是用于查询的对象。查询主要是通过操作表、视图、索引等数据库对象来实现的,这些对象包含了实际存储的数据,并且可以被查询操作所使用。
1年前 -
数据库对象查询是指在数据库中查询和检索数据库对象的操作。数据库对象是指数据库中存储的各种数据实体,例如表、视图、索引、存储过程、触发器等。因此,数据库对象查询包括对这些对象的查询和检索。
然而,并不是所有的操作都可以被归类为数据库对象查询。以下是一些不属于数据库对象查询的操作:
-
数据库连接:数据库连接是指应用程序与数据库之间建立的连接通道。数据库连接的建立是在应用程序中进行的,而不是在数据库中进行的查询操作。
-
数据库创建和删除:数据库的创建和删除是指创建和删除整个数据库的操作,这是在数据库管理系统中进行的管理操作,不属于查询操作。
-
数据库用户和权限管理:数据库用户和权限管理是指管理数据库用户、分配权限等操作,这也是在数据库管理系统中进行的管理操作,不属于查询操作。
-
数据库备份和恢复:数据库备份和恢复是指对数据库进行备份和恢复的操作,这是在数据库管理系统中进行的管理操作,不属于查询操作。
-
数据库性能优化:数据库性能优化是指对数据库的性能进行调优的操作,包括索引优化、查询优化等。这是在数据库管理系统中进行的管理操作,不属于查询操作。
总之,数据库对象查询是指对数据库中存储的各种数据实体进行查询和检索的操作,而其他的数据库管理和维护操作不属于数据库对象查询。
1年前 -